pediatric intubation manikins are essential tools used in medical training programs to help healthcare professionals practice and improve their intubation skills on pediatric patients. Intubation is a critical procedure that involves inserting a flexible plastic tube into the windpipe to help a patient breathe. It is commonly performed in emergency situations, surgeries, and intensive care units to provide oxygen and assist with ventilation. Intubation can be a challenging procedure, especially in pediatric patients, who have unique anatomical differences that require specialized care and expertise.
The use of pediatric intubation manikins provides healthcare professionals with a safe and controlled environment to practice and master their intubation skills before performing the procedure on real patients. These manikins are designed to closely simulate the anatomy of pediatric patients, including the size and structure of the airway, vocal cords, and trachea. They are available in different sizes and shapes to represent infants, toddlers, and older children, allowing healthcare providers to practice intubation techniques on patients of all ages.
One of the main benefits of using pediatric intubation manikins is that they provide a realistic and hands-on learning experience for healthcare professionals. By practicing on a lifelike model, medical students, residents, and practicing clinicians can develop the confidence and skills needed to perform successful intubations in real-life clinical settings. These manikins accurately mimic the feel and resistance of a patient’s airway, allowing trainees to practice proper techniques, such as laryngoscope insertion, tube placement, and cuff inflation, in a controlled and repeatable manner.
In addition to improving technical skills, pediatric intubation manikins also help healthcare providers develop critical thinking and decision-making abilities. Through simulated scenarios and case studies, trainees can learn to assess the patient’s condition, anticipate potential complications, and make quick and informed decisions during intubation procedures. By practicing on a manikin, healthcare professionals can refine their problem-solving skills and enhance their ability to respond to challenging situations with confidence and competence.
Another advantage of pediatric intubation manikins is that they allow for continuous feedback and evaluation of performance. Many modern manikins are equipped with sensors and monitoring devices that provide real-time data on the trainee’s performance, such as insertion depth, ventilation quality, and hand positioning. This objective feedback helps healthcare providers identify areas for improvement, track progress over time, and receive guidance on how to enhance their intubation skills effectively. By analyzing performance metrics and adjusting their techniques accordingly, trainees can optimize their intubation proficiency and ensure safe and successful outcomes for their pediatric patients.
